Authorship and Creation
Smiling Irish Eyes was produced by John McCormick[18]. It was directed by William A. Seiter[4]. Thomas J. Geraghty wrote the screenplay for it[5]. Cast members include Colleen Moore[9], James Hall[10], Robert Homans[11], Claude Gillingwater[12], Julanne Johnston[13], and Barney Gilmore[14].
Publication
Smiling Irish Eyes was published on +1929-01-01T00:00:00Z[25]. The original language of it was English[21]. Genres include musical film[7] and silent film[8].
